This 2006 Carver 36 Mariner is a fiberglass cruiser built around generous interior volume and open sightlines. The elevated salon with panoramic windows provides natural light and headroom, while the wide 12.75-foot beam contributes to the spacious feel throughout. Three Mercruiser gasoline engines deliver 600 horsepower for dependable cruising power. The layout flows from a private forward stateroom through the main salon to a large aft deck, with a flybridge offering commanding views and additional seating above.
Accommodations include a forward stateroom with storage, a convertible dinette that serves as additional sleeping space, and a full galley with refrigerator, cooktop, microwave, and cabinetry. An enclosed head with shower and vanity rounds out the interior, along with generous storage lockers throughout. Wide side decks with molded steps ensure safe passage, while an integrated swim platform provides direct water access.
The yacht's design emphasizes comfort and entertaining space. The large aft deck works well for relaxing or social gatherings, and the flybridge layout encourages time spent on deck. Carver's construction quality and the 36 Mariner's thoughtful proportions deliver the feel of a larger boat while remaining manageable for typical owners.
